>>> Dear List,
>>> The PhD thesis by Christophe Stoelinga, an in depth study on the
>>> psychomechanics of rolling sounds carried out at Eindhoven University of
>>> Technology and at ENSTA in Paris, has now appeared in paperback:
>>> http://www.amazon.com/Psychomechanical-Study-Rolling-Sounds/dp/363912299
>>> 2/ref=sr_1_4?ie=UTF8&s=books&qid=1236803714&sr=8-4.  I would say this is
>>> mandatory reading for all of you who are interesting
>>> in acoustics and the way we perceive sound, in the ecological psychology
>>> of hearing, and in the way we use sound to recontruct an image of what
>>> happens around us.
